CPES is an amazing school! My daughter has been at this school since kindergarten and she is presently in the 4th grade. Love, love, love the principal, teachers, and staff. They have many teachers that run after school programs. They take time out of their busy schedules to get involved with the kids. When there are PTA fundraisers, you will see many of the teachers come and stay to hang out with the kids. They have an amazing PTA leadership that rewards everyone. Here are some of the school programs that are offered, Chess Club, Girls On The Run, Let Me Run, News Team, Classroom councilor representatives, ... This school has a mixture of students from all around the world, which makes the school very unique. I love that my daughter interacts with so many cultures and gains a worldly perspective everyday. My advice to you is, get to know the staff by volunteer in any way you can. With all of our wonderful experiences, we feel very blessed that our daughter attends CPES !
